The City of Clawson has an outdoor market in the summer, and the Clawson Farmers Market has changed its name and look. The Summer Sunday Park Market is held every Sunday from May 22 to June 26 from 9 am to 1 pm. On Wednesdays, there is the Wednesday In Town Market, which is held at 139 West 14 Mile Road. Fall Festival

The annual Fall Festival is a popular fall event in Clawson Park, MI. Free hayrides, a rock climbing wall, farm animals, and baked goods are among the many family-friendly events. The Clawson Fire Department supervises a community bonfire to cap the festivities. A variety of food vendors sell local fare, and a car show and a farmers market are other highlights.

Cinema in the Street

If you’re looking for an outdoor summer movie, Clawson Park, Michigan, is a great option. 14 Mile Rd, north of Tacoma Street, will close at 4:30p so they can set up the giant movie screen. The pre-movie entertainment and games will begin at 6:30p, with the movie itself starting at dusk. Bring lawn chairs and blankets to enjoy the show.
